Study on Synthesis Procedure of Rare Earth Citrate Complexes from Ln(La,Ce)Cl3 Solutions in Laboratory Scale at 100g/Batch

Description

Synthesis processing of rare earth (La, Ce) citrate complexes were carried out in laboratory scale of 100g/batch from 200g/L concentration Ln(La, Ce)Cl3 solutions that is calculated by total rare earth oxides in which 50% La2O3 and 50% CeO2. Rare earth citrate complexes were synthesized by using citric acid and Ln(La,Ce)Cl3 solution. The experimental results showed that the optimum conditions are as follows: time reaction is 5 hours, temperature is 80℃, pH is 3.5, molar ratio of materials is 1.25∶1. The efficiency of the complexing reaction was over 95% at scale 100g/batch. The formula and chemical composition of the rare earth citrate complexes were determined by thermal analysis, infrared spectroscopy and ICP-MS. This research products will be added to feed in the further studies. (author)
